Clinton lost against Odessa back in September of 2023,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Friday. The Clinton Cardinals were outmatched by the Odessa Bulldogs at home and fell 37-7. The loss continues a trend for the Cardinals in their matchups with the Bulldogs: they've now lost eight in a row.
Kanden Lafarge threw for 186 yards and a touchdown.
Brody Barnhart was his top target, picking up 67 receiving yards and a touchdown. On the ground,
Markus Oliver rushed for 78 yards.
Clinton's defeat dropped their record down to 0-2. As for Odessa, the win also got them back to even at 1-1.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Clinton will take on Summit Christian Academy at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Odessa, they will look to take advantage of their home-field for the first time this season as they take on Mexico at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
